Product Description

The Structural Concepts NE3613HSV Reveal® Hot Food Display is a compact, slide-in heated counter case designed for bakeries, cafés, and convenience stores. With its convection heat, stainless steel interior, and LED top light, the display ensures even warming and an attractive presentation. The swing-out vertical glass, glass ends, and rear sliding doors provide easy access to the contents. This unit is cETLus, ETL-Sanitation, and DOE 2017 compliant, and measures 35-3/4" wide, 33" deep, and 13-5/8" high above the counter, with an overall height of 32-7/8".
